Review Comment:
   `grantAccess` throws `IllegalArgumentException` for client errors (no 
permission / unknown email). There is no `ExceptionMapper` for 
`IllegalArgumentException` in this repo (only `UnauthorizedExceptionMapper`), 
so these exceptions are likely to surface as HTTP 500 instead of a 4xx. Use 
JAX-RS exceptions to guarantee the intended status codes.
